<div class="method">
<code class="details" id="create">create(parent, body=None, inboundSamlConfigId=None, x__xgafv=None)</code>
<pre>Create an inbound SAML configuration for an Identity Toolkit project.
Args:
parent: string, The parent resource name where the config to be created, for example: &quot;projects/my-awesome-project&quot; (required)
body: object, The request body.
The object takes the form of:
{ # A pair of SAML RP-IDP configurations when the project acts as the relying party.
&quot;displayName&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# The config&#x27;s display name set by developers.
&quot;enabled&quot;: True or False, # True if allows the user to sign in with the provider.
&quot;idpConfig&quot;: { # The SAML IdP (Identity Provider) configuration when the project acts as the relying party. # The SAML IdP (Identity Provider) configuration when the project acts as the relying party.
&quot;idpCertificates&quot;: [ # IDP&#x27;s public keys for verifying signature in the assertions.
{ # The IDP&#x27;s certificate data to verify the signature in the SAMLResponse issued by the IDP.
&quot;x509Certificate&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# The x509 certificate
},
],
&quot;idpEntityId&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Unique identifier for all SAML entities.
&quot;signRequest&quot;: True or False, # Indicates if outbounding SAMLRequest should be signed.
&quot;ssoUrl&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# URL to send Authentication request to.
},
&quot;name&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# The name of the InboundSamlConfig resource, for example: &#x27;projects/my-awesome-project/inboundSamlConfigs/my-config-id&#x27;. Ignored during create requests.
&quot;spConfig&quot;: { # The SAML SP (Service Provider) configuration when the project acts as the relying party to receive and accept an authentication assertion issued by a SAML identity provider. # The SAML SP (Service Provider) configuration when the project acts as the relying party to receive and accept an authentication assertion issued by a SAML identity provider.
&quot;callbackUri&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Callback URI where responses from IDP are handled.
&quot;spCertificates&quot;: [ # Output only. Public certificates generated by the server to verify the signature in SAMLRequest in the SP-initiated flow.
{ # The SP&#x27;s certificate data for IDP to verify the SAMLRequest generated by the SP.
&quot;expiresAt&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Timestamp of the cert expiration instance.
&quot;x509Certificate&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Self-signed public certificate.
},
],
&quot;spEntityId&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Unique identifier for all SAML entities.
},
}
inboundSamlConfigId: string, The id to use for this config.
x__xgafv: string, V1 error format.
Allowed values
1 - v1 error format
2 - v2 error format
Returns:
An object of the form:
{ # A pair of SAML RP-IDP configurations when the project acts as the relying party.
&quot;displayName&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# The config&#x27;s display name set by developers.
&quot;enabled&quot;: True or False, # True if allows the user to sign in with the provider.
&quot;idpConfig&quot;: { # The SAML IdP (Identity Provider) configuration when the project acts as the relying party. # The SAML IdP (Identity Provider) configuration when the project acts as the relying party.
&quot;idpCertificates&quot;: [ # IDP&#x27;s public keys for verifying signature in the assertions.
{ # The IDP&#x27;s certificate data to verify the signature in the SAMLResponse issued by the IDP.
&quot;x509Certificate&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# The x509 certificate
},
],
&quot;idpEntityId&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Unique identifier for all SAML entities.
&quot;signRequest&quot;: True or False, # Indicates if outbounding SAMLRequest should be signed.
&quot;ssoUrl&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# URL to send Authentication request to.
},
&quot;name&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# The name of the InboundSamlConfig resource, for example: &#x27;projects/my-awesome-project/inboundSamlConfigs/my-config-id&#x27;. Ignored during create requests.
&quot;spConfig&quot;: { # The SAML SP (Service Provider) configuration when the project acts as the relying party to receive and accept an authentication assertion issued by a SAML identity provider. # The SAML SP (Service Provider) configuration when the project acts as the relying party to receive and accept an authentication assertion issued by a SAML identity provider.
&quot;callbackUri&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Callback URI where responses from IDP are handled.
&quot;spCertificates&quot;: [ # Output only. Public certificates generated by the server to verify the signature in SAMLRequest in the SP-initiated flow.
{ # The SP&#x27;s certificate data for IDP to verify the SAMLRequest generated by the SP.
&quot;expiresAt&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Timestamp of the cert expiration instance.
&quot;x509Certificate&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Self-signed public certificate.
},
],
&quot;spEntityId&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Unique identifier for all SAML entities.
},
}</pre>
</div>
